Freight allowed describes an agreement between a buyer and a seller, in which the buyer pays for the cost of shipping, and the seller deducts this from the invoice. Convoy enjoyed all the trappings of a runaway tech success. Its two co-founders, Dan Lewis and Grant Goodale, had Amazon and Ivy League credentials. Convoy counted Jeff Bezos, Bill Gates and (bizarrely) Bono among its investors.

On Tuesday, Descartes reported that February imports to all U.S. ports totaled 1,734,272 twenty-foot equivalent units. That’s down 16.2% from January, 25% year on year and 0.3% versus February 2019, pre-COVID. Imports from China were particularly weak, given COVID issues and the Lunar New Year break.

Chart: ( SONAR: NTIL.USA ). The National Truckload Index (linehaul only – NTIL) is based on an average of booked spot dry van loads from 250,000 lanes. The NTIL is a seven-day moving average of linehaul spot rates excluding fuel. Spot rates are still 15% lower year over year.
